If you use social networking platforms as one of the ways you establish your professional identity, or to attract, connect or interact with potential or current clients and colleagues, your social media presence has become part of your professional space. This means that legal and ethical provisions may apply to your online activities.

Put a social media policy in place BEFORE you start using social media.

News feed is where people spend 40% of their time on Facebook – it’s where your posts need to be seen and shared

Make them short –100 - 250 characters

Use visuals – photos & videos are most popular

Use Page Insights to find out the best times to post

Facebook Posts

Invite people you know to “like” your Page

Email existing contacts – friends, family etc

Promote your FB address on marketing materials eg business cards, flyers

Create FB adverts – get more Page likes, promote Page posts

2) Connect with people

Page 11: How to use Facebook, LinkedIn & Twitter to promote a new business

3) Engage your audience Post quality content regularly – 1-2 times a

week

Ask questions or invite people to contribute – calls to action!

Give access to exclusive information/content

Make them offers to share with friends

Respond to comments & private messages

Page 12: How to use Facebook, LinkedIn & Twitter to promote a new business

When fans interact with your posts, their friends see it in their news feed

Offer a special discount to people who share your posts

Keep track of the posts that people share most using Page Insights – and do more of the same!

4) Influence friends of fans

Complete your personal profile – include an attention grabbing headline & lots of keywords

Use a professional photo Join special interest groups & participate in

discussions Ask for recommendations for your services Post every morning and include photos,

links, files, questions

LinkedIn – Personal Profile

Demonstrate your expertise and make yourself relevant to your followers: Share photos and videos Join in, don’t just talk at people Comment on industry news Talk about projects you’re working on,

events you’re attending Answer FAQs and share real-life case studies

Joining in….
